Security Settings (Firewall) Menu<br />

Configuring Your <strong>Gateway</strong><br />

The Security Settings (Firewall) menu lets you enable or disable the <strong>Gateway</strong>’s firewall. In<br />

addition, the submenus associated with this menu let you:<br />

� Configure access control settings ⎯ see page 39<br />

� Configure your <strong>Gateway</strong> for special applications ⎯ see page 47<br />

� Set up URL blocking ⎯ see page 50<br />

� Schedule routes ⎯ see page 52<br />

� Receive email or syslog alert notifications ⎯ see page 53<br />

� Configure a local client computer as a local DMZ for unrestricted two-way Internet<br />

access ⎯ see page 56<br />

Enabling or Disabling Firewall<br />

The Security Settings (Firewall) menu provides an option for enabling or disabling the<br />

<strong>Gateway</strong>’s firewall setting. To access the Security Settings (Firewall) menu, click Firewall in<br />

the menu bar. Figure 20 shows an example of the menu.<br />

By default, your <strong>Gateway</strong>’s firewall settings are enabled. To disable the firewall, uncheck<br />

Enable Firewall Mode.<br />
